POCO C61: A Budget-Friendly Phone with a Big Display and Long Battery Life

Avatar photo

By

Surbhi


The POCO C61 is a recent entry into the budget smartphone market, offering a large display, a decent battery, and a stripped-down feature set at an attractive price point. Launched in April 2024, it caters to users looking for a reliable phone for everyday tasks without breaking the bank. Let’s delve deeper into what the POCO C61 brings to the table.

Design and Display

The POCO C61 boasts a large 6.71-inch HD+ display with a waterdrop notch. While not the sharpest on the market with a 720 x 1650 resolution, it offers ample screen real estate for watching videos, browsing the web, and gaming. The 90Hz refresh rate is a welcome surprise at this price range, providing smoother scrolling and animations compared to traditional 60Hz displays.

The phone comes in a “Radiant Ring Design,” according to POCO, which translates to a textured back that promises a comfortable grip and a stylish look. It’s available in Ethereal Blue and likely other color options, though details on those are limited at this time.

Performance and Hardware

Under the hood, the POCO C61 is powered by the MediaTek Helio G36 processor, a budget-oriented chipset aimed at everyday tasks. Paired with 4GB of RAM, it should handle basic applications like social media, messaging, and light browsing with ease. However, demanding games and multitasking might push its limits. Storage starts at 64GB, which is sufficient for most users, but there’s also a microSD card slot for expandable storage.

Cameras

The camera department on the POCO C61 is basic. The rear setup consists of an 8MP primary sensor and a secondary 0.08MP sensor, likely for depth effects. Don’t expect flagship-level image quality here. The 5MP front-facing camera should suffice for casual selfies and video calls.

Battery Life

One of the POCO C61’s strong points is its battery life. It packs a massive 5000mAh battery, which is becoming increasingly common in budget smartphones. With moderate usage, you can expect a full day or more on a single charge. However, the charging speed is limited to 10W, which might feel slow compared to some competitors offering fast charging solutions.

Software

The POCO C61 runs Android 14, the latest version of Google’s operating system at the time of launch. This ensures access to the latest features and security updates. However, since it’s a POCO device, a custom user interface (UI) might be layered on top of stock Android, potentially adding bloatware or altering the overall look and feel.

Price and Availability

The POCO C61 is currently available in India, with a starting price of ₹6,999 (approximately $85) for the 4GB RAM and 64GB storage variant. There’s no official word on global availability yet.
